Transaction cd90c750cb721816af1d2ada18de7dbff34923de3bd3e727c8324df9add53132

2 Input
2 Outputs
  • cd90c750cb721816af1d2ada18de7dbff34923de3bd3e727c8324df9add53132:0
  • value  578670000
    address  39icaRMGmnwF3WT24RMv2AaVyYH3NLhKcq
  • cd90c750cb721816af1d2ada18de7dbff34923de3bd3e727c8324df9add53132:1
  • value  137108463
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A